Moxie is great on a physical sweeper with lots of coverage, Intimidate is great on anything that works like a tank. Gyaraos COULD work as something tankish and it's speed is only VERY slightly above average (81 instead of 78) but my main problem is that I sort of don't think that it's coverage is all that great. Moxie doesn't really help if you need to switch alot, unlike Intimidate...
I suppose you could do something with Earthquake, Stone Edge and Dragon Tail...

Actually I may as well post my VGC team here. Been getting some good use out of it.
Dere ya go.
Actually I may as well post my VGC team here. Been getting some good use out of it.
- VGC 2k14:
Linn (Shao on Showdown) [F]
Ability: Regenerator
Stat stuff: Jolly, 252 Atk/252 Spe/4 Sp.Def
Item: Focus Sash
Moves: Fake Out/Drain Punch/Knock Off/Rock Slide
Gotta love Mienshao. It's just so good at doing what it does! Linn earned her place on the team because I was using Scrafty as a Mega Kanga killer and was just really unsatisfied with good Ol'Moe's killing power and speed. So, come in Linn! Fake Out is to stop Mega Kanga from doing it itself, Drain Punch is a useful STAB that deals a hefty chunk to Mega Kanga and also heals up Linn if she's taken some small damage, meaning the Sash doesn't go to waste. Knock off hits Aegislash for decent damage, as well as Gengar (both types) and Meowstic Male too, so is definitely worth having round. Rock Slide destroys Talonflame and Mega Chari Y, and does a little damage to a whole bunch of other stuff with a nice flinch chance.
Ruby [F]
Ability: Prankster
Stat stuff: Calm, 252 HP/252 Sp.Def/4 Def
Item: Leftovers
Moves: Will-o-wisp/Taunt/Swagger/Foul Play
You gotta love it when OU sets work just as stunningly well in VGC, don't ya? Ruby is really, really useful. Will-o-wisp spreads Burn around like it's nobody's business. Mega Kanga and Garchomp especially feel its heat. Depowering those up is just so vital to have, especially seeing as they're basically the best two Pokemon in VGC and can absolutely not be left unchecked because they WILL hurt you badly.
Taunt probably doesn't need an explanation, but just in case: Amoognuss, Meowstic Male, Smeargle, Mega Venusaur, Other Sableye, Klefki, Anything I think might want to Trick Room, Mega Gengar, Normal Gengar. Oh, and if I ever wanna stop something from using the present-on-pretty-much-every-vgc-Pokemon Protect, it helps there too. Taunt is just so damned useful.
Swagger and Foul Play are just delicious together, and allow Ruby to not only cripple physical attackers but special ones too. Half chance of your opponent not attacking? Yes please. Plus Foul Play on anything defensive is just beautiful. Especially when you consider that because it uses the opponent's attack, Any intimidate user is not gonna bother me. Neither is King's Shield.
Vaike [M]
Ability: Mold Breaker
Stat stuff: Adamant, 252 Atk/240 Spe/16 HP
Item: Lum Berry
Moves: Dragon Dance/Protect/Dragon Claw/Earthquake
Taking a leaf out of Dee's book here and using what is effectively his Haxorus set. To be honest, I kinda consider Vaike here to be Garchomp in many ways. He has a very similar moveset to what Garchomps run. So why didn't I just use Garchomp? Simple answer: Mold Breaker Earthquake. Having it around is really useful, especially in a Meta where Rotom Heat is actually more common than Rotom Wash (only by one place in the rankings, mind you). Non Mega Gengar targeting is also useful. Also it will kill the few things with Sturdy in VGC in one hit, so there's always that.
Anyway, Dragon Dance means that you're fast enough to go first against most things, and either offsets the Intimidate you just got handed or boosts you up one point. Protect is necessary in VGC. Like literally unless if you have really good recovery options (Mienshao), are very difficult to touch (Sableye) or are running a Choice set, you need Protect. Always. It's just really handy, and I've used Protect on Haxorus especially once he's boosted up to lure both enemy attacks and allow Vaike's partner (omg I just realised how I'm using Fire Emblem characters for the first time in a Doubles team where partnering up is a massive part of strategy hahaha that's hilarious) to KO something. Dragon Claw is a useful STAB, basically. Lum Berry to curb Will-o-wisps and Thunder Waves should I get a Prankster who Ruby hasn't or can't deal with.
Elizabeth [F]
Ability: Blaze // Drought
Stat stuff: Modest (I think my ingame is Timid though), 172 HP/60 Def/252 Sp.Atk/24 Spe
Item: Charizardite Y
Moves: Protect/Overheat/Solarbeam/HP Ice
Gotta love how Charizard lends itself so nicely to English Royalty names (Charles, Lizzie/Elisabeth), right? But yeah, Lizzie is my Mega, and also definitely the highest tier Pokemon I have on this team. She just kinda worked well for what I wanted her for. I use Protect for obvious reasons. The rest of her set might seem a little odd, but it works. Overheat under Drought is just NASTY, and will almost definitely OHKO anything weak to Fire. Anything that has a meh Special Defense will also get dealt a nasty chunk too, if not also be OHKOd.
Speaking of Drought, how about a nice Solarbeam to go with it? Useful for clearing the field of Water types.
Actually on the note of Water types, Elizabeth and her Partner that I'm gonna talk about next are my primary destroyers for Drizzletoad. They work really well, even if they're all I really have. All I need to do is be careful of Drizzletoads that run Rain Dance in addition to Drizzle (because that's definitely a strategy that happens) and I'm set.
Finally, HP ice deals with what it usually deals with. No tier is safe from things that are 4x weak to Ice, it seems, so having it around is pretty vital. Especially for Garchomp. I can't always rely on Ruby or Vaike to deal with Garchomps. And actually tbh Elizabeth is the Pokemon use the most to take them out, purely for HP Ice. Once they're burned they can't really do anything to her before she can kill them.
Damsel [F]
Ability: Speed Boost
Stat stuff: Modest (again my ingame is Timid I think), 4 HP/252 Sp.Atk/252 Spe
Item: Life Orb
Moves: Protect/Air Slash/Bug Buzz/Solarbeam
Ok, ok, I know what you're thinking. He's using a YANMEGA? Really? The answer of course is yes, of course I am, can't you tell what a Pokemon is from its sprite jfc guys. No but seriously, Damsel is an invaluable member of my team. I do definitely have a bit of a problem with using Protect on everything in VGC, I don't like how restricting it is, so when I thought of using Damsel, I was pretty happy, because Speed Boosters tend to run Protect even in Singles.
Anyway, after a +2 Damsel beats a Swift Swimming Ludicolo, which was a big factor in me choosing her. Not that that is every really a problem, because I tend to be able to time my Mega on Elizabeth well. Actually come to think of it I don't think there's ever been a battle where I've used Damsel but not Elizabeth. Probably because if I'm using Damsel, the enemy's team is probably also going to need Elizabeth to beat. It work well reallly.
Anyway! Life Orb is really nice for giving Damsel a little extra punch. Big Buzz deals with Ludicolo, Meowstic and a bunch of other less common threats that still need a reliable check. I also use it when I just want to deal damage, because it's Damsel's strongest move after STAB. Air Slash has mad usage. Amoonguss is a common target, but so are stuff like Scrafty or Mienshao. And finally, Solarbeam. Enemies fielding double Water is extremely common, plus messing around with Protect means that sometimes I prefer for Elizabeth to not attack ona certain turn where I need to take out say a Politoed of something, so I use Solarbeam on Damsel too. And actually, I can't say there's ever been a situation where I've wanted a different attack, so I'm pretty happy that it's there.
Kellam [M]
Ability: Rock Head
Stat stuff: Adamant, 252 HP/252 Atk/4 Sp.Def
Item: Expert Belt
Moves: Head Smash/Iron Head/Dragon Claw/Protect
Oh look another Fire Emblem character. Anyway, Kellam is here for three primary reasons.
1. Rock Head Smash
2. Fairies.
3. Rock Head Tyrantrum is yet to be released. (For reference, my team if it was would be Tyrantrum/Excadrill instead of Haxorus/Aggron most likely)
The amount of things in VGC weak to rock is actually pretty high. So why not pack something to utterly destroy them? I definitely needed a reliable Talonflame counter. Linn and her Rock Slide are great and all, but considering how common Talonflame and Charizard Y are, I needed something a little more reliable to deal with them. A Head Smashing Aggron does that pretty well, especially when you consider that said Aggron won't take any damage from that Head Smash due to his ability. But Head Smash's usage doesn't stop there! With expert belt, Aggron OHKOs Gyarados (AFTER Intimidate). Head Smash also deals with Zapdos, Salamence and Aerodactyl to name just a few. Any STAB of that power is also going to be threatening to anything it hits neutrally too.
Iron Head is pretty much just there for Gardevoir and other slightly less used Fairies, but I've found it to be of some use elsewhere, such as Tyranitar or Aerodactly too.
Dragon Claw is a coverage move. Interestingly enough I don't tend to use Kellam and Vaike in the same battle a lot of the time, and I've found that since Knock off and Foul Play have been added to my team (I wasn't suing them before), a Dragon move is much more useful for coverage.
